2. Quantification of bergenin, antioxidant activity and nitric oxide inhibition from bark, leaf and twig of Endopleura uchi
Phytochemical investigation of Endopleura uchi led to the isolation of a gallic acid derivate, known as bergenin (2) and friedelin (1), a pentacyclic triterpene. The present work also reports the bergenin quantification in different Endopleura uchi bark, twig and leaves extracts. Our findings showed the highest bergenin concentration in bark methanol extract
